From Remote Control to AI Supervision: How Astropad's 2026 Pivot Signals a Fundamental Shift in Workforce Management

Date: 2026/04/08

On April 8, 2026, Astropad announced a strategic pivot for its Remote Desktop software, shifting its core focus from connectivity to "AI supervision" and explicitly targeting "agents" as its primary user segment. This move, presented as a product evolution, represents a fundamental recalibration of remote desktop technology's role in the digital workspace. The transition from a tool for access to a platform for oversight signals a new phase in the management of distributed labor, where the primary value is derived not from enabling work, but from monitoring and optimizing it.

Beyond the Headline: Decoding the 2026 Pivot from Access to Oversight

The surface-level interpretation of Astropad's announcement is a feature update. The deeper reality is a strategic repositioning in response to the maturation of remote and hybrid work models. For over a decade, competition in the remote desktop sector centered on technical metrics: latency reduction, image fidelity, and user experience. These features have become commoditized. The logical, albeit controversial, next step is to leverage the unique position of remote desktop software—which sits directly on the endpoint—to provide intelligent oversight.

The pivot to "AI supervision" is an inevitable convergence of endpoint management and AI-driven analytics. Industry analysis from firms like Gartner had previously forecasted this trend, noting the growing enterprise demand to move beyond simple device management to "behavior-aware" endpoint platforms that provide contextual insights into work patterns (Source 1: [Industry Forecast, Gartner, 2025]). Astropad's move is a direct response to this market demand, transforming its software from a conduit into an analytical layer.

The Hidden Economic Logic: Monetizing the Management Layer

The economic driver behind this pivot is clear. Margins on basic remote access have eroded due to competition and standardization. Vendors like Astropad are compelled to seek higher-value services. "Supervision" represents a service layer with greater monetization potential than "access."

The business model shifts from selling seat licenses for connectivity to selling insights, compliance assurance, and productivity analytics to enterprise managers. This transforms the customer from the end-user (the agent) to the employer or operations team. The value proposition is no longer "enable your employee to work remotely" but "understand and optimize how your remote employee works."

Targeting "agents"—a term denoting roles in customer support, sales, data entry, and other structured, task-based functions—is a calculated focus on a measurable, ROI-driven segment. The work of agents is more easily quantified and analyzed by AI for metrics like activity levels, process adherence, and output quality. This makes the agent the new, optimized unit of economic value for this class of software, allowing for clear demonstrations of efficiency gains and risk mitigation.

The Unspoken Entry Point: The Ethical and Operational Tightrope of AI Supervision

This technological pivot is not merely a product update; it is an intervention in the employer-employee power dynamic within digital space. The deployment of pervasive AI supervision tools through the remote desktop layer creates an unprecedented level of transparency into work processes. The long-term operational impact could be the further standardization and potential de-skilling of agent work, as AI identifies and enforces "optimal" workflows. This could make remote labor more interchangeable and subject to intensified global competition based on efficiency metrics.

Such a shift does not occur in a vacuum. It invites significant regulatory and cultural scrutiny. Emerging legal frameworks, such as the European Union's AI Act, which classifies certain workplace AI systems as high-risk and subjects them to strict transparency and human oversight requirements, will directly shape how "AI supervision" features can be deployed (Source 2: [Regulatory Framework, EU AI Act, 2024]). Furthermore, academic studies on workplace surveillance consistently point to correlations between intensive electronic monitoring and increased employee stress, which can impact turnover and long-term productivity (Source 3: [Academic Review, 'Personnel Psychology', 2023]). The success of this pivot will depend on Astropad's and its clients' ability to navigate this tightrope between operational control and ethical governance.

Conclusion: The New Battleground for the Digital Workspace

Astropad's 2026 announcement is a leading indicator of a broader market transformation. The battleground for the future of the digital workspace is shifting from the quality of connection to the intelligence of control. Remote desktop software is poised to become the central nervous system for managing distributed, agent-driven workforces, providing a continuous stream of data for AI to analyze.

The neutral prediction for the industry is a rapid bifurcation. Vendors will either specialize as high-performance connectivity utilities or evolve into AI-powered workforce intelligence platforms. The latter will increasingly integrate with other enterprise systems—project management, CRM, HRIS—to create a holistic, automated oversight environment. The adoption curve will be steepest in industries with large, distributed agent populations, such as customer service, insurance, and logistics. The ultimate trajectory of this trend will be determined not by technological capability alone, but by the evolving equilibrium between managerial efficiency, regulatory boundaries, and the renegotiated social contract of work.
